Program Details
Instructor: Dr. Yasin Salimibeni Duration: 5 hours This course provides practical insights and tools to integrate artificial intelligence (AI) into your engineering workflows. We'll start with foundational concepts in AI, machine learning (ML), and large language models (LLMs), exploring how these can enhance your work. Throughout, we’ll cover the strengths and limitations of AI, including practical applications like document retrieval, error detection, and knowledge processing, with a focus on responsible AI use in engineering. By the end, you’ll be ready to use AI tools effectively, increasing both efficiency and innovation. Chapter 1: Foundations of AI and Data Science - Introduction to AI & ML: Learn the basics of AI, machine learning, and how they differ. - The Role of Data: Explore data’s importance in AI, including types and preparation. - Generative AI & LLMs: Understand AI’s content generation with examples like ChatGPT, effective prompting, and use cases across industries. - Simplified Key Terms: Break down jargon like neural networks, tokens, and temperature. - Machine Learning Basics: Discover how machine learning leverages data, and why data literacy matters in every job. - Responsible AI Use: Gain best practices for security and responsible AI applications. Chapter 2: Applied AI for Engineering Building on the fundamentals, we apply AI concepts to engineering: - Document Processing & Retrieval: Learn to automate document verification and retrieval for optimized workflows. - LLMs and RAG: Discover advanced search applications in technical documentation using retrieval-augmented generation. - Optimizing AI Outputs: Explore tokens, temperature, and tuning for tailored outputs. - AI in Complex Tasks: See how AI assists with calculations and simulations, enhancing decision-making and data-driven insights. - Best Practices: Understand strategies for verifying AI outputs, collaborating effectively with AI, and recognizing potential risks.
